    This film is structured around nine tableaux, which build up a detailed picture of Scozzi's personality, interweaving form and content to convey her inner and outer worlds, the things which fascinate her and the agonies she goes through, as accurately as possible, providing a lively, humorous picture of a composite creative artist.

    Trained as a dancer, an actress, a photographer and a mime artist, Laura Scozzi now creates performances she herself calls "theatrical dance".
    She founded her own dance company Opinioni in Movimento in 1991, and went on to choreograph several acclaimed creations for it. Coline Serreau and Laurent Pelly chose her to stage several of their recent works, and she has also worked on cinema shorts and feature films.

    In the Seventies, France discovered a generation of new American choreographers mostly from New York. Among these artists, Lucinda Childs was one of the dominant figures.

    Their style and working methods were to upset the artistic and choreographic scene of the time. A new avant-garde had arrived that closely combined dance, music and graphic art.
    Lucinda Childs first studied contemporary dance with Merce Cunningham. She created the so-called "Judson Church" movement together with other young choreographers such as Yvonne Rainer, Steve Paxton, Trisha Brown, David Gordon and Robert Morris. This movement continued officially until 1968 but still influences choreographic creation now more than ever.
    Lucinda Childs began creating for the stage from 1973. She has received a number of commissions from major ballet companies since 1981. These include the Paris Opéra Ballet, the Pacific Northwest Ballet, the Berlin Opera Ballet, the Rambert Dance Company, Bayerisches Staatsballett, the Ballets of Monte Carlo, the Ballet of the German Opera on the Rhine, and the White Oak Dance Project.
    In 2002, Childs was invited to choreograph Gluck's opera "Orphée et Eurydice" and then Benjamin Britten's "Chalcony" for Baryshnikov. Finally she put "Dance" on again which was originally created in 1979, for the Ballet of the German Opera on the Rhine.
    The documentary explores the exceptional personality of Lucinda Childs and puts her career into perspective with her own comments added on.

    For this documentary, we go to Grenoble, Gallotta's home town, where he founded his dance company. He guides us through his favourite places, talking passionately about his work in careful sentences and voluble, expressive body language.

    For this documentary, we go to Grenoble, Gallotta's home town, where he founded his dance company. In his rehearsal studio, in the outbuilding where he made a film, at the crossroads, on the hills and promontories overlooking the city, in the woods of his childhood, he guides us through his favourite places, talking passionately about his work in careful sentences and voluble, expressive body language. The film cuts back and forth between the interview and the dancers in rehearsal, gradually demonstrating the principles which underpin his work - broken rhythms, minimalist sketched-in movements, sobriety, improvisation, literature and the importance of words, total assimilation of movement into the body and between dancers, desire, play and transmission.
    The pieces illustrated in the film are Mamame and Presque Don Quichotte.

    Guillaume just became the first Black star dancer in the history of the Paris Opera, and France. Sulivan, a double bass player from Martinique, is the first and only Black woman to have been selected to join the prestigious Opera Academy. Each in their own way, they are determined to fully embrace their black identity and denounce the discrimination and archaisms of the institution.

    Guillaume now wants to own his role model status  while proving that he is not the company's diversity alibi. In 10 months, Sulivan will have to leave the academy. In the meantime, she has to find her place in a very conservative environment, where people assume she's a jazz musician and where she got used to arriving early so as not to be blamed for the supposed indolence of West Indians. Her goal: to prove that she is talented enough to join the Paris Opera orchestra. Two young artists, symbols of a change of era, during this very special opera season for them, each with their own share of uncertainties and questions, fears, disappointments and joys, failures and successes.
